The Onsite Client Mobility Manager is responsible providing onsite support to our client, including responsibility for escalation support and reporting requests. They ensure that client's Mobility program is executed in compliance with the policy and Graebel's standards to ensure consistency and efficiency in operations. We are committed to fair and transparent compensation. The salary range for this role is based on several factors including experience, skills, and qualifications and is $72,000 to $80,000. Essential Duties and Responsibilities Documents and maintains timely and accurate client requirements and profile information, maintains Visa Global Mobility Smart Recruiters Operational reporting daily. Enters authorizations globally based on client-provided report. Provide timely and accurate reporting. Coordinates authorizations between Graebel global offices (tri-regionally). Act as a Tier One contact for questions from the client's recruiters and/or relocating employees and manages Visa's Mobility mailbox. Acts as a Tier One contact for exceptions; review any that require the discretion of the Visa Director of Global One-Way Relocations. Responsible for client facing of a global account. Works with client to provide value added solutions to their identified goals. Monitor and reviews service delivery escalations and works with appropriate parties to resolve issues to the client's satisfaction. Builds positive working relationships with global operations teams and other Client support groups to agree on root cause, develop solution to prevent reoccurrence. Research any client invoice processing data and provides missing information to Graebel to ensure data invoice accuracy. Liaise with immigration team as appropriate to provide support as part of the service initiation process. Perform any other related duties as required or assigned.
